Sheila Dikshit sends legal notice to Kejriwal for defamation

The CM's political secretary Pawan Khera issued the notice through an advocate to Kejriwal and warned of legal action if the activist does not immediately apologise for his "derogatory remarks".
In a talk show that was recently aired on three TV channels, Kejriwal referred to Sheila Dikshit as a "dalal". The legal notice stressed that the activist must "immediately withdraw all the allegations and aspersions made by you against Sheila Dikshit."
Kejirwal has also been asked to "tender an unconditional public apology... to his satisfaction through print and electronic media with regard to the said baseless allegations and aspersions and using foul and filthy language."
The notice adds that if Kejriwal fails to comply with it, he will render himselves "liable to face appropriate civil as well as criminal proceedings under the relevant provisions of law."
However, the activist reacted to the notice with another jibe at the CM. In a public riposte to Sheila Dikshit, Kejriwal asserted: "Yes we are defaming you... and will continue to do so till the time you continue with corruption."
The CM's actions are giving her a bad name and his words cannot be blamed for that, he said. Of late, he has been leading the IAC's campaign against inflated electricity bills in New Delhi.
Kejriwal has alleged that the Delhi government is colluding with power companies and harassing the people.
